The Telecom Regulatory Authority of India (TRAI) today released the “Indian Telecom Services Performance Indicator Report” for the Quarter ending June 2009. This Report provides a broad perspective of the Telecom Services and presents the key parameters and growth trends for the Telecom Services in India for the period covering April-June 2009, and is compiled on the basis of information furnished by the Service Providers.

Highlights of the Report – Cable TV, DTH & Radio Broadcast services

  • Total Number of channels registered with Ministry of I&B is 447. There are 136 pay channels as reported by 24 broadcasters/their distributors at the Quarter ending Jun-09.
  • Maximum number of TV channels being carried by any of the reported MSOs is 262 whereas in conventional analogue form, the maximum number of channels being carried by the reported MSOs is 100 channels.
  • The number of private FM Radio stations in operation increased from 245 in March-09 to 248 in June-09.
  • Besides the free DTH service of Doordarshan, there are 6 private DTH licensees. 5 DTH licensees are offering pay DTH services to the customers as on 30.06.2009 and their reported subscriber base is 15.17 million.
  • Number of Set Top Boxes (STBs) installed in CAS notified areas of Delhi, Mumbai, Kolkata and Chennai increased from 770,053 in Mar-09 to 816,192 in June-09.
